Dark Shadows: Movie Review
The beginning of this movie takes place in 1752 when Barnabas Collins breaks the heart of a witch and she dooms to being a vampire for the rest of eternity. Two centuries later he rises from his grave and finds himself in 1972. He returns to his home, Collinwood Manor to find it in ruins and to also find whats left of the Collins family with all their own problems as well. As Barnabas tries to get used to the new century he has many different challenges along the way.
In the year 1752 Joshua and Naomi Collins set sail to America with their young son Barnabas Collins in hope for a better life. The Collins settle in Maine where they build a fishing empire, within two decades Barnabas is rich and powerful. But when he makes a mistake of breaking a witches heart she gives him a fate worse than death, turning him into a vampire and then burying him alive. Two centuries later Barnabas arises from his grave and find himself in 1972. After he wakes up he returns to his home in Collinwood Manor, but when he gets there he only finds his mansion in ruins and whats left of the Collins family having troubles of their own. The only family member Barnabas trusts with his secret is Elizabeth Collins Stoddard, a family matriarch. Although everybody else is suspicious they would never guess that Barnabas could be a vampire. As he sets out to restore his family to its original glory, there is one thing that stands in his way, the Collinsport,s leading denizen who goes by the name Angie who thinks he has a remarkable resemblance to their ancestor Barnabas Collins who is out to prove this. Although he has restored his family’s greatness they have found out his secret.
I would recommend this movie to just about anybody. This movie could have used a little bit more action to go along with its hilarious comedy, but other than this it was a great movie. But this is a movie I would see in theaters before you buy it on DVD because you either like it or you don’t.
